OMFS 652
Dental Anesthesiology I: Local Anesthesia

Catalog description
Students will learn to apply their understanding on core BMS material, bringing together their knowledge of applied head and neck and dental anatomy, with knowledge of pharmacology and neuroanatomy. Students will learn how to evaluate a patient for local anesthesia, including informed consent, and management of phobic patients, and they will learn some of the standard techniques using a typodont. Students have the option to provide local anesthesia to peers by agreement.
